Out & About - Yew Tree Cottage sits on Western Road in Newick - a quintessentially English village with a thriving community. Its central green is the heart of the village and amenities include village shop, newsagent, pharmacy, butcher, bakery, post office, hairdressers, three public houses (The Bull, The Royal Oak and The Crown), Newick Tandoori Indian restaurant (a real favourite with the locals) and a health centre. Fletching, another beautiful village is 2 miles north-east and boasts another the superb 'Griffin Inn' gastropub. For commuters, the bustling town of Haywards Heath is six miles to the west and easily accessible via the A272. The mainline station provides swift, regular commuter services to London (Victoria/London Bridge in 47 mins), Gatwick Intentional Airport (15 mins) and Brighton (20 mins).

The town also boasts extensive shopping facilities with Waitrose and Sainsbury's superstores and the Orchards Shopping Centre. The attractive market town of Uckfield is 5 miles east and offers plenty of amenities including a fantastic independent cinema and railway station.

The recently opened Marks & Spencers Food Hall at nearby Piltdown is less than 10 mins away and is brimming with fresh food and has a dedicated wine shop.

Education wise, there is a wide range of highly regarded schools and colleges to choose from in the nearby villages and towns, both state and private sector, including Newick primary school, Chailey Secondary School, Cumnor House in Danehill, Great Walstead near Lindfield, Worth Abbey, Burgess Hill School for Girls and Lewes Grammar.
